Black SUV drives recklessly, damages state propertyMonterey County CA

audio iconTraffic
San Juan Rd, California

A black SUV drove recklessly through construction cones near Cozy Bend, hit a white wall, and went on two wheels. The vehicle continued driving southbound with a traffic cone stuck underneath. It damaged state property. The incident was witnessed by a driver in a white Subaru who followed the SUV with hazard lights on. The SUV was last seen exiting near San Juan Road and was the third vehicle under the bridge.
